What Are 3D Printers And How Do They Work?
3D printers work by understanding a 3D file and replicating its design using filament or resin one layer at a time. Slicing is a method used to prepare most 3D models for printing. The 3D model can then be “sliced” and printed on a machine.
What Is The Definition Of An Industrial 3D Printer?
An industrial 3D printer, unlike a home 3D printer, is designed for organizations that want to develop new prototypes or cut manufacturing costs by using 3D printing.
Businesses are increasingly using 3D printers for rapid prototyping to reduce new product development time by allowing them to 3D print in-house, eliminating the time lag associated with having manufacturers provide prototypes. Multiple prototypes can be tested and iterated on an hourly, or even daily basis, resulting in significantly faster and better products.
